Magento 2-Fehler: Beim Generieren dieser E-Mail ist leider ein Fehler aufgetreten

14

Ich erhalte unter Fehler im lokalen System von Magento 2.

Es tut uns leid, beim Generieren dieser E-Mail ist ein Fehler aufgetreten.

Rakesh Verma
quelle

Antworten:

10
  1. Aktivieren Sie den Entwicklermodus über die Befehlszeile php bin/magento deploy:mode:set developer
  2. Cache über die Kommandozeile leeren php bin/magento cache:flush
  3. Laden Sie die Front-End-Seite neu
  4. Nach dem Neuladen der Seite ändert sich die Meldung in

Fehler beim Filtern der Vorlage: Die Datei kann nicht in das Verzeichnis \ C: / xampp / htdocs / Magento / pub / media / catalog / product \ cache \ f073062f50e48eb0f0998593e568d857 / m / b geschrieben werden. Zugang verboten.

  1. Folgen Sie diesem Link, um /magento/170376/magento-2-unable-to-write-file-into-directory-access-forbidden zu beheben
  2. Cache leeren
  3. Laden Sie die Front-End-Seite erneut
  4. Wenn Sie nach dem Aktivieren des Entwicklermodus eine andere Nachricht sehen, können Sie sie googeln.
Kareem Sultan
quelle
5

Wechseln Sie zunächst zu Ihrer .htaccess-Datei. Kommentar entfernen

SetEnv MAGE_MODE developer

Die Fehlermeldung ist zu 90% irreführend und höchstwahrscheinlich liegt ein XML-Parsing-Problem vor. In beiden Fällen wird der Fehler durch Einschalten der Entwicklerumgebung und Löschen des Caches behoben.

Ohne Ihr Fehlerprotokoll ist es schwierig, eine genaue Diagnose zu erstellen. Einige Benutzer werden sagen, dass sendmail diesen Fehler behebt. Dies liegt jedoch im Allgemeinen daran, dass der Fehler versucht, per E-Mail an Sie gesendet zu werden, und dass Sie sich nicht in der richtigen Entwicklungsumgebung befinden, um das Problem zu beheben. Dies kann daran liegen, dass Sie sich im Standard- oder Produktionsmodus befinden, der für die Behebung von Problemen nicht ideal ist.

Das sendmail-Modul soll den Betrieb einer Site ermöglichen. Wenn Probleme mit der Site auftreten, kann der Entwickler benachrichtigt werden, und der Fehler hat hoffentlich kein Problem mit der vollständigen Darstellung der Site verursacht. Auf diese Weise kann eine Site weiterhin ohne Kenntnis der Benutzer betrieben werden, und das Problem kann von einem qualifizierten Entwickler hinter den Kulissen behoben werden.

Brian Ellis
quelle
Nach dem Einstellen des Entwicklermodus wird ein weiterer Fehler angezeigt. "Ressourcen konnten nicht geladen werden ......"
Sarower Jahan